O.C.G.A. § 16-12-30 (2019)
[Reserved] Seizure and destruction of gambling devices
History
Code 1933, § 26-2708, enacted by Ga. L. 1968, p. 1249, § 1; Ga. L. 1969, p. 857, § 13; Ga. L. 1985, p. 888, § 2; repealed by Ga. L. 2015, p. 693, § 2-13/HB 233, effective July 1, 2015.
Annotations
Editor’s notes. Ga. L. 2015, p. 693, § 2-13/HB 233 repealed and reserved this Code section, effective July 1, 2015. Ga. L. 2015, p. 693, § 4-1/HB 233, not codified by the General Assembly,
provides that: “This Act shall become effective on July 1, 2015, and shall apply to seizures of property for forfeiture that occur on or after that date. Any such seizure that occurs before July 1, 2015, shall be governed by the statute in effect at the time of such seizure.” Law reviews. For article on the 2015 amendment of this Code section, see 32 Georgia St. U.L. Rev. 1 (2015).
